Set Instant Pot to saute and add olive oil. Rub seasoned salt and roasted garlic and herbs on pork roast on both sides. When hot add pork roast and sear on both sides, turn Instant Pot off.
Take roast out and cut into 3 pcs.
Pour 1 c of your broth into your pressure cooker and use a wooden spoon to loosen the pcs of cooked on meat off of the bottom of your pot (called deglazing your pot so the burn notification doesn't come on later).
Put pork roast pcs back into your pot with diced onions and last cup of broth.
Close lid and steam valve. Set pot to pressure high for 60 minutes.
Allow steam to naturally release.
Open lid. Shred pork with forks, remove fat pieces and discard those. Put shredded pork into a bowl.
Discard remaining liquid left in pressure cooker and put meat back into your pot.
Mix all remaining ingredients above together with a whisk until cornstarch is dissolved.
Put pressure cooker on saute, low, and add sauce mixture.
Put shredded pork in your bowl into your pot and mix with sauce.
Allow to bubble just slightly so sauce thickens a bit and pork is thoroughly coated with sweet sauce.
Serve on top of rice or in slider buns, top with green onions and sesame seeds if desired.
